Skip to content

Commit 9ace184

Browse files
committed
Fix annotation pipeline logs
1 parent 7c9f9ee commit 9ace184

File tree

1 file changed

+9
-4
lines changed
  • Late adults stats pipeline/DRrequiredAgeing/DRrequiredAgeingPackage/R

1 file changed

+9
-4
lines changed

Late adults stats pipeline/DRrequiredAgeing/DRrequiredAgeingPackage/R/sideFunctions.R

Lines changed: 9 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-4480,7 +4480,9 @@ minijobsCreator = function(path = getwd(),
44804480
type = '*.tsv') {
44814481
lf = list.dirsDepth(path = path, depth = depth)
44824482
a = paste0(
4483-
'sbatch --job-name=impc_stats_pipeline_job --mem=1G --time=2-00 -e error.err -o output.out --wrap="find ',
4483+
'sbatch --job-name=impc_stats_pipeline_job --mem=1G --time=2-00',
4484+
' -e ', basename(lf), '_error.err',
4485+
' -o ', basename(lf), '_output.log --wrap="find ',
44844486
lf,
44854487
' -type f -name "',
44864488
type,
@@ -6464,11 +6466,14 @@ IMPC_HadoopLoad = function(SP.results = getwd(),
64646466

64656467
DRrequiredAgeing:::minijobsCreator()
64666468
system('chmod 775 minijobs.bch', wait = TRUE)
6467-
submit_limit_jobs(bch_file="minijobs.bch", job_id_logfile="../../../compressed_logs/minijobs_job_id.txt")
6469+
DRrequiredAgeing:::submit_limit_jobs(bch_file="minijobs.bch", job_id_logfile="../../../compressed_logs/minijobs_job_id.txt")
64686470
DRrequiredAgeing:::waitTillCommandFinish(
64696471
WaitIfTheOutputContains = waitUntillSee,
64706472
ignoreline = ignoreThisLineInWaitingCheck
64716473
)
6474+
6475+
system(command = "find . -type f -name '*.log' -exec zip -m ../../../compressed_logs/minijobs_logs.zip {} +", wait = TRUE)
6476+
system(command = "find . -type f -name '*.err' -exec zip -m ../../../compressed_logs/minijobs_logs.zip {} +", wait = TRUE)
64726477

64736478
DRrequiredAgeing:::message0('Moving single indeces into a separate directory called AnnotationExtractorAndHadoopLoader ...')
64746479
system('rm -rf AnnotationExtractorAndHadoopLoader/', wait = TRUE)
@@ -6529,7 +6534,7 @@ IMPC_HadoopLoad = function(SP.results = getwd(),
65296534
wait = TRUE
65306535
)
65316536

6532-
submit_limit_jobs(bch_file="annotation_jobs.bch", job_id_logfile="../../../../compressed_logs/hadoop_load_job_id.txt")
6537+
DRrequiredAgeing:::submit_limit_jobs(bch_file="annotation_jobs.bch", job_id_logfile="../../../../compressed_logs/hadoop_load_job_id.txt")
65336538
DRrequiredAgeing:::waitTillCommandFinish(
65346539
WaitIfTheOutputContains = waitUntillSee,
65356540
ignoreline = ignoreThisLineInWaitingCheck
@@ -6542,7 +6547,7 @@ IMPC_HadoopLoad = function(SP.results = getwd(),
65426547

65436548
DRrequiredAgeing:::message0('Zipping logs ...')
65446549
setwd(file.path(SP.results, 'AnnotationExtractorAndHadoopLoader'))
6545-
system('zip -rm logs.zip log/* err/* out/*', wait = TRUE)
6550+
system('zip -rm ../../../../compressed_logs/annotation_logs.zip log/* err/* out/*', wait = TRUE)
65466551
system('zip -rm splits.zip split_index_*', wait = TRUE)
65476552

65486553
DRrequiredAgeing:::message0('Job done.')

0 commit comments

Comments
 (0)